Cutting-Edge Technology


Gold-hunting robots have cutting-edge technology to navigate and operate in challenging environments. Here are some key features of these remarkable machines:


  • AI and Machine Learning:
  • These robots are powered by advanced AI algorithms and machine learning models that enable them to learn from their surroundings. They can analyze geological data, identify potential gold deposits, and make real-time decisions based on the information they gather.


  • Autonomous Navigation:
  • Gold-hunting robots are designed to be fully autonomous. They can traverse rugged terrains, avoid obstacles, and adapt to changing conditions without human intervention. This capability enhances safety and allows for continuous operation in remote areas.


  • Sensors and Detectors:
  • These robots are equipped with various sensors and detectors, including spectrometers and electromagnetic sensors, that can detect trace amounts of gold in the soil or rock. This level of sensitivity enables them to pinpoint potential gold deposits with remarkable precision.


  • Environmental Adaptability:
  • Gold-hunting robots are built to withstand extreme environmental conditions, from scorching deserts to freezing tundras. Their durability and adaptability make them well-suited for prospecting in various climates.


Advantages of Gold-Hunting Robots


The adoption of gold-hunting robots offers several significant advantages to the mining industry:


1. Safety Enhancement

Mining has historically been a dangerous profession, with risks ranging from cave-ins to toxic gas exposure. Gold-hunting robots eliminate many risks by taking over the most difficult tasks. They can explore unstable areas, work in environments with hazardous substances, and withstand conditions that would be life-threatening to humans.


2. Increased Efficiency

Gold-hunting robots can work around the clock without rest or breaks. Their efficiency is unmatched, as they tirelessly collect data, analyze samples, and search for potential gold deposits. This leads to faster and more accurate prospecting, ultimately saving time and resources.


3. Precise Prospect Identification

Thanks to their advanced sensors and AI-driven analysis, these robots can accurately pinpoint gold deposits. This reduces the need for extensive and costly drilling, as mining companies can focus their efforts on the most promising sites, leading to higher yields and reduced environmental impact.


4. Environmental Conservation

Gold mining often has adverse environmental consequences, including deforestation, habitat destruction, and water pollution. Gold-hunting robots can minimize these impacts by conducting targeted and non-invasive prospecting, thereby reducing the ecological footprint of mining operations.


Challenges and Considerations


While gold-hunting robots hold tremendous promise, there are some challenges and considerations to be addressed:


1. Initial Investment

The development and deployment of gold-hunting robots require substantial upfront investments. Mining companies must carefully weigh these costs against the long-term benefits of increased safety and efficiency.


2. Maintenance and Repair

Robotic systems, like any machinery, require regular maintenance and occasional repairs. Ensuring the availability of skilled technicians and spare parts in remote locations can be challenging.


3. Ethical and Social Implications

Adopting automation in mining may lead to job displacement for human workers. Mining companies must consider this transition's social and ethical implications and invest in training and reskilling programs for affected employees.


Regulatory Considerations


With the rise of gold-hunting robots in mining, regulatory bodies, and governments worldwide are facing the task of creating and implementing guidelines and policies that govern the use of this technology. These regulations are crucial to ensure these machines' responsible and ethical deployment. Some critical areas of regulatory consideration include:


Environmental Impact Assessment


Mining operations, even those assisted by robots, can still significantly impact the environment. Governments may require mining companies to conduct thorough environmental impact assessments before deploying gold-hunting robots. These assessments would evaluate potential harm to ecosystems, water sources, and local communities.


Worker Transition Plans


To address the potential job displacement caused by automation, governments, and mining companies must work together to develop comprehensive worker transition plans. These plans could include job retraining, support for alternative employment, and measures to mitigate the socioeconomic impact on communities reliant on mining.


Safety Standards


Safety remains a top priority in mining operations. Regulations should set clear safety standards for deploying and operating gold-hunting robots, ensuring that these machines do not compromise worker safety or community well-being.
